Comprehending Tilt and Turn Windows

Tilt and turn windows are designed with an unique mechanism that allows users to open the window in 2 ways: tilting it inward for ventilation or totally turning it open for maximum gain access to. This dual functionality makes them an appealing choice for lots of house owners. Nevertheless, the detailed machinery involved can sometimes cause repair requirements.

Tilt and turn windows, like all windows, can experience problems over time. Here are some typical problems that may require interior repair:

  1. Sticking Mechanism: The window may not open or close smoothly due to dirt accumulation or misalignment.
  2. Weather Condition Stripping Wear: Over time, sealing strips can wear down, resulting in drafts and decreased energy effectiveness.
  3. Broken Handles: The manages can end up being loose or break, making it hard to run the window.
  4. Glass Issues: Cracks or chips in the glass can occur, resulting in possible security risks and decreased insulation.
  5. Mechanical Failure: The internal hardware can malfunction, preventing the window from functioning appropriately.

Lots of small repairs can be taken on by house owners. Here's a step-by-step guide to some common DIY fixes for tilt and turn windows.

Step 1: Inspect the Window

Before starting any repair, perform a comprehensive inspection of the window. Check for the following:

  • Alignment and performance of the hinges
  • Condition of the weather condition stripping
  • Functionality of deals with
  • Any damage to the glass or frame

Action 2: Address Sticking Mechanisms

  1. Tidy the Hinges: Use a soft brush or vacuum to get rid of dirt and debris. Apply a silicone-based lube to make sure smooth movement.
  2. Straighten the Window: If the window is misaligned, adjust the hinges according to the maker's guidelines.

Action 3: Replace Weather Stripping

  1. Remove Old Stripping: Gently pry off the used weather stripping.
  2. Cut New Stripping: Measure and cut the new weather condition removing to size.
  3. Install New Stripping: Press the brand-new stripping into place, ensuring a tight seal.

Step 4: Fix or Replace Handles

  1. Tighten Up Loose Handles: Use a screwdriver to tighten any loose screws.
  2. Replace Broken Handles: Follow the manufacturer's directions to remove the old handle and set up a new one.

Step 5: Repair Glass Issues

  1. Small Cracks: Use a glass repair package to fill in little cracks following the package guidelines.
  2. Replacement: For larger fractures or damage, think about hiring a professional glazier to replace the glass.
When to Call a Professional

While numerous repair work can be done independently, some problems require the know-how of a professional. You must consult a specialist if:

  • The window's internal mechanism is damaged or malfunctioning beyond basic repairs.
  • The glass is shattered or severely broken.
  • You require replacement parts that are specific to the window model.
  • There are structural problems with the window frame.

Q3: What type of lubricant should I use?

A silicone-based lube is advised for the systems of tilt and turn windows, as it will not bring in dirt or dust.
